It has been cultivated in China since the beginning of the 19th century. In Chinese cuisine, Tremella fuciformis is traditionally used in sweet dishes. While it is tasteless, it is appreciated for its gelatinous texture as well as for its bioactive properties. It is common to make a dessert soup called luk mei (六味) in Cantonese, often in combination with tropical fruits and other ingredients. It is also used as an ingredient in a drink and as ice cream.
It is considered the mushroom of beauty because it has substances with action similar to hyaluronic acid. Used in recipes for face creams.
